WebHealthy Families America is a voluntary home visitation program designed to promote healthy families and children through a variety of services, including child development, access to health care, and parent education. The program targets families identified as at risk, with children ages 0 to 5. Web- Home visitors offer participating families long-term services (usually 3 to 5 years), beginning intensively (at least one visit per week), ... WebHealthy Beginnings requires families to initiate services prenatally during the third trimester. Services are provided until the child is 2 years old. The model includes eight home visits during this period. Healthy Beginnings’ service population includes the following: Families with low incomes. Indigenous families.
